All eyes are now on Ezekiel Elliott after the Cowboys tag Tony Pollard

Things are about to heat up around the Dallas Cowboys, the heat I have been waiting for. With the team placing the franchise tag on Tony Pollard Monday afternoon, the focus now shifts to Ezekiel Elliott and I have my popcorn ready. 

Let get right to it, Zeke is set to count for $16.4 million against the salary cap with a $10.4 million base salary. Yikes! I have talked about this time and time again recently. They have two options, make Elliott take a gigantic pay cut, or simply release him. 

Zeke told the team after the season ended that he would be willing to take that pay cut to stay with the team. Look, I like Elliott. Yes, he is nowhere near what he used to be and just don’t have much left, but he can still punch the ball in the end zone and pick up short yardage first downs. That is all they need him for. 

When Jerry did his favorite thing last week (speaking to the media), he told folks that the knee injury to Zeke was the primary reason for him setting a career low 876 rushing yards last season. Although that probably added to the problem, I just don’t think he has that burst anymore. 

With Pollard receiving the tag, I would guess the team is working on a long-term contact. I really hope they learn from what they got themselves into with Zeke’s huge pay day, and not dish out a ton of money for him.
